# Hello Kitty and Friends library card rolls out in LA County, limited edition cards and themed programs launches
*LA County Library and Sanrio debut a first-ever collaboration, offering a limited-edition Hello Kitty® and Friends card and month-long activities at all 87 branches.*

Beginning Sep 18 and running through Oct 18, LA County Library and Sanrio® are celebrating Library Card Sign-up Month with the system’s first partnership with the iconic Hello Kitty® brand, unveiling a limited-edition Hello Kitty® and Friends library card, co-branded bookmarks, stickers, and a slate of themed programs for patrons of every age. The initiative, announced in a press release by the County of Los Angeles, is designed to highlight storytelling, friendship, creativity and imagination while encouraging residents to sign up for a library card and explore the system’s extensive resources.

The collaboration, described as Sanrio’s “first-of-its-kind” library partnership, invites Angelenos to visit any of the 87 LA County Library locations to pick up the exclusive card while supplies last, with a $1 replacement fee for existing cardholders during the promotion. Library officials stress that the card is a “key to a lifetime of learning, inspiration, creativity, and connection,” and that the Hello Kitty® and Friends theme will be woven into activities ranging from early-learner art projects to adult journaling socials.

## HOW TO GET THE CARD · How to get the limited-edition Hello Kitty® and Friends card

The limited-edition card becomes available on Friday, Sep 18, 2026 at any LA County Library branch; it is distributed on a first-come, first-served basis and cannot be reserved, with a limit of one card per account user while supplies last [https://lacountylibrary.org/hellokittyandfriends/](https://lacountylibrary.org/hellokittyandfriends/). New patrons must complete a library-card application and present a valid photo ID, while existing patrons may swap their current card for the special design by paying a $1 replacement fee during the month-long promotion [https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/](https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/).

The County’s library-card policy accepts a single form of identification such as a California driver’s license, California ID, or a consular ID, and also permits a combination of two documents (for example, a utility bill plus a photo ID) to verify address [https://lacountylibrary.org/library-cards/](https://lacountylibrary.org/library-cards/). Parents or legal guardians are encouraged to bring children when signing up, as children are eligible for the limited-edition card provided a parent or guardian signs the application and accompanies the minor to the branch.

Because the cards are limited in quantity, library staff advise patrons to arrive early and be prepared for a brief wait. The $1 replacement fee applies only during the Sep 18-Oct 18 window; after that, standard replacement costs of $3 resume. Cardholders who receive the special design will have a new card number and must update that number in the Library app and digital platforms such as Libby and Kanopy.

## THEMED-PROGRAMMING · Hello Kitty®-themed programming for all ages

From Sep 18 through Oct 18, each branch will host self-guided activities and displays, including character scavenger hunts, coloring sheets, and curated reading lists featuring Hello Kitty® and Friends titles. These free resources are designed to spark curiosity and encourage visitors to explore the library’s broader collections [https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/](https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/).

Early-learner programs focus on friendship-themed stories and hands-on art, with sessions such as “Read Together, Share Together,” Cinnamoroll™’s Pom Pom Cafe, Pochacco™’s Tissue Art, and Keroppi™’s Donut Pond Paper Craft. School-age children and teens can join creative workshops that include friendship-bracelet making, bookmark crafting, character-inspired art, fuse-bead designs, origami and embroidery. Adult patrons are offered character-inspired reading lists, a journaling and craft social where they can personalize journals, planners and scrapbooks, and free distribution of exclusive Hello Kitty® and Friends bookmarks and stickers [https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/](https://lacounty.gov/2026/09/16/la-county-library-launches-summer-programs-for-all-ages-2/).

All activities are free, open to the public, and aim to blend the beloved Sanrio characters with the library’s mission of lifelong learning.
